Bank of Kathmandu Lumbini Limilted is formed following the merger of Bank of Kathmandu and Limbini Bank, has become a prominent name in the Nepalese banking sector. BOK started its operation in March 1995 with the objective to stimulate the Nepalese economy and take it to newer heights. BOK also aims to facilitate the nation’s economy and to become more competitive globally. BOK has today become a landmark in the Nepalese banking sector by being among the few commercial banks which is entirely managed by Nepalese professionals and owned by the general public.
Network
Bank of Kathmandu Limited has 50 Branches, 58 ATM, 7 extension counter & 24 Branchless Banking Service Point across the country.
